项目摘要
We have developed instruments for precise measurements of ozone precursors (NOx,HNO_3,PAN,VOCs, and CO), OH and HO_2 radicals, and actinic flux. Measurement campaigns using these instruments were conducted in different seasons in 2003-2005. Especially, in July-August 2004, intensive measurements were made at two sites ; one in Tokyo and the other in Kisai-city in Saitama. At the same time, aerosol chemical composition at each size range was measured using an Aerodyne Aerosol Mass Spectrometer. Air mass which left Tokyo reaches Saitama in the afternoon, providing ideal conditions for investigationg chemical processes during transport. In mid-August, sea-land breeze developed under the influence of stable high pressure system. Under these conditions, O_3 reached high levels in northern Tokyo around 1300 LT. This O_3 levels further increased while the air mass was transported to Saitama by sea breeze. During the transport, NOx oxidation and O_3 formation occurred simultaneously. Organic aerosol was observed to be formed efficiently under high O_3 conditions. 3D-CTM has been developed taking into account the chemical and transport processes. This model well reproduces O_3 and precursors in Kanto area. By this model, it is indicated that O_3 was produced within a few hours near noon.
